A Graduate Certificate in Anti-Bullying Initiatives equips professionals with the knowledge and skills to design and implement effective anti-bullying programs. The program focuses on creating safe and inclusive environments for children and adults alike, addressing various forms of bullying including cyberbullying and harassment.
Learning outcomes include a deep understanding of bullying prevention strategies, intervention techniques, and the legal and ethical considerations involved. Graduates will be proficient in data analysis related to bullying trends and in the development of culturally sensitive, evidence-based initiatives. This specialization in conflict resolution and restorative practices is key.
The duration of the certificate program typically ranges from six months to one year, depending on the institution and course load. Many programs offer flexible online learning options, catering to busy professionals seeking professional development in school safety and community outreach.
This Graduate Certificate holds significant industry relevance for educators, school counselors, social workers, human resource professionals, and community leaders. Graduates are highly sought after by organizations committed to fostering positive and respectful work and learning environments. This certificate enhances career prospects in youth development, workplace wellness, and conflict management.
The program often incorporates case studies, simulations, and practical experience, providing a robust understanding of bullying prevention and intervention. The curriculum usually covers topics such as trauma-informed care, restorative justice, bystander intervention, and the impact of bullying on mental health.
